Market Definition & Overview

The Smart Port Automation Market encompasses the integration and deployment of advanced digital technologies and autonomous systems within port infrastructure to enhance operational efficiency, safety, sustainability, and connectivity. It involves leveraging technologies such as the Internet of Things (IoT), artificial intelligence (AI), machine learning, robotics, and automation to streamline cargo handling, optimize vessel traffic management, improve security, and facilitate intelligent decision-making across port operations. This market focuses on transforming conventional ports into smart, data-driven hubs that can autonomously manage various functions, reduce human intervention, and improve overall throughput and environmental performance within the Smart Harbor Infrastructure industry.

Scope

  • Global coverage, spanning key maritime trade regions across all continents
  • Analyzes various automation levels from semi-automated to fully autonomous port operations
  • Covers the period from current year up to a seven-year forecast horizon

Inclusions

  • Automated Guided Vehicles (AGVs) and Autonomous Stacking Cranes (ASCs)
  • Automated Ship-to-Shore (STS) Cranes and Rubber-Tyred Gantry (RTG) Cranes
  • Vessel Traffic Management Systems (VTMS) with AI capabilities
  • Port Management Information Systems (PMIS) for integrated operations
  • IoT sensors and networks for real-time monitoring and data collection within ports
  • Predictive analytics and machine learning for maintenance and operational optimization

Exclusions

  • Traditional, non-automated port equipment and infrastructure without smart features
  • General logistics and supply chain management software not specific to port automation
  • Inland transportation automation systems not directly integrated with port operations
  • Maritime security solutions independent of port automation infrastructure
  • Shipboard automation systems that operate autonomously without direct port integration

Regional Analysis

  • Asia-Pacific leads the smart port automation market due to its high volume of global trade, significant government investments in infrastructure, and continuous drive for operational efficiency. Countries like China and Singapore are at the forefront, adopting advanced robotics and AI to manage extensive container traffic and minimize turnaround times.
  • Europe is emerging as the fastest-growing region for smart port automation. This growth is fueled by stringent environmental regulations, a strong emphasis on sustainability, and the need to optimize port operations amid labor shortages. European ports are rapidly integrating digital solutions and automation to enhance efficiency and reduce their carbon footprint.
  • An emerging trend across European ports focuses on achieving full carbon neutrality through smart automation. This involves integrating renewable energy, electrifying equipment, and optimizing operations with AI to drastically reduce emissions. European initiatives drive sustainable port development and cleaner shipping logistics.

Competitive Landscape

#CompanyShareKey StrategyKey NoteKey DevelopmentsKey Products
1

Cargotec

5.7%

Drive automation and digitalization across container handling and cargo flow to enhance operational efficiency and sustainability for ports.

A global leader in cargo and load handling solutions, known for its extensive portfolio including Kalmar and MacGregor brands.

Kalmar launched its fully electric reachstacker, expanding its eco-efficient equipment portfolio for terminal operations.

Kalmar SmartPortNavis N4MacGregor Port Solutions+1
2

Kaleris

5.4%

Provide integrated cloud-based logistics and terminal operating solutions that optimize operations across rail, intermodal, and port ecosystems.

Formed from multiple acquisitions, focusing on end-to-end supply chain execution and visibility solutions, including the Navis suite.

Kaleris acquired PINC Solutions, enhancing its real-time visibility and yard management capabilities for global supply chains.

Kaleris Terminal Operating SystemNavis SmartYard Management System+1
3

Konecranes

5.1%

Deliver advanced lifting solutions and services, focusing on automation, digitalization, and electrification for ports and terminals.

A world-leading group of Lifting Businesses, serving a broad range of customers with productivity-enhancing lifting solutions.

Konecranes expanded its Port Solutions portfolio with new generations of eco-efficient straddle carriers and Automated RTG (ARTG) systems.

Automated Stacking CranesAutomated Rail Mounted GantryContainer Gantries+1
4

Wärtsilä

4.9%

Enable sustainable societies and planet through innovation in marine and energy sectors, focusing on digitalization and smart technologies.

Known for its comprehensive portfolio spanning marine engines, propulsion, and smart technologies that connect ships, ports, and shore infrastructure.

Wärtsilä signed an agreement to provide its Smart Port solutions for a major terminal in the Middle East, enhancing operational efficiency and safety.

Smart Marine EcosystemVoyage Optimization SolutionsPort and Terminal Management Systems+1
5

ST Engineering

4.6%

Leverage advanced engineering and technology to develop smart city solutions, including integrated smart port capabilities for enhanced security and efficiency.

A global technology, defense, and engineering group with a strong presence in smart city solutions and critical infrastructure.

ST Engineering partnered with a major port authority to implement its digital port platform, integrating various operational systems for greater efficiency.

AGIL Smart Port SolutionsTerminal Operations & ManagementVessel Traffic Management Systems+1
